Altered Trek-1 Function in Sortilin Deficient Mice Results in Decreased Depressive-Like Behavior

The background potassium channel TREK-1 has been shown to be a potent target for depression treatment. Indeed, deletion of this channel in mice resulted in a depression resistant phenotype.
